We have an English learning school for grade 1 to grade 6 in Tainan City, Taiwan.
Our teaching style is more open and fun than typical cram schools in Taiwan. We don't focus on book and homework as much as we do activities and getting children involved in practical use of English, through projects and other forms of hands on learning.Tipos de ayuda y oportunidades de aprendizaje

You can learn Chinese and Taiwanese languages in here, experience traditional Taiwanese culture, celebrate festivals and holidays with us, and enjoy amazing food of Taiwan. You will meet our teachers who have many talents and life experiences to share.

You will be helping our teachers on classes to do activities, you won't be the only teacher in the class, so don't worry if you don't have any experience in teaching, as long as you like children and know how to have fun. We would like you to share your culture to our kids, tell them about your country, your life experiences, or something you love. Also, it will be good if you can talk (just chatting) with our kids when you see them, it doesn't have to be something serious, so they can have chances to practice speaking English on their daily lives.

You will be living in the building of the studio where you can use all the space. There have bathrooms, showers with hot water, a well-equipped kitchen, and all the rooms are with air conditioners, and good wifi connection everywhere. In the room has bed mattresses and private cabinets.
We provide lunch and dinner, you will be eating with us, having some decent Taiwanese food everyday. There is also food and basic ingredients in the kitchen all the time, if you want to cook or bake. And it's very easy to get something to eat around the area.
Our studio is located in Anping district where includes most of the tourist attractions of Tainan City. It's close enough that you can walk or ride bicycle around to see all the interesting spots in Tainan.Algo más...
Tainan is a city you have to visit in Taiwan. Since it's the old capital of Taiwan, there are many historic sights to see, and an old port where you can have a boat ride. Tainan has a long coastline with good beach, if you like to get tanned, we are close to the beach and it's sunny all year round here.
Tainan is known as the city of food, we have famous and delicious food all over the streets, not only Taiwanese but also exotic. There are few night markets in Tainan, that everyone loves. Night market is an interesting culture of Taiwan, where you can have food, buy cheap stuff, and play games.Un poco más de información
